The project is located 65 Kms (40 miles) from Nagpur.It entails giving a Ambulance detailed as under :-
Go-Vigyan Anusnadhan Kendra (GVAK) a NGO established in the year 1996 and engaged in the manufacture of cow based medicinal
products. The objective of the Institution is development of medical awareness and hygiene in the rural and tribal areas. It has its
research centre in Devalpar a small village, 65 KM away from Nagpur. They regularly hold medical camps and awareness programs in
villages and tribal areas within the radius of 150 KM covering about 400 villages and population of about 4-5 lacs. These tribal and
rural areas lack in medical facilities and services on regular basis. They are largely dependant upon this NGO who regularly organizes
medical camps and awareness programs.
GVAK is a well known and reputed NGO. They have requested a grant of Rs. 1.26 million ( $ 23500) for the purchase of
medical ambulance to offer medical services and relief and to deal with medical urgency in rural and tribal area. The proposed
ambulance shall be utilized in these medical camps and awareness programs. The proposed vehicle is a three beded ambulance. It is like
a mini clinic to treat the tribals and villagers more effectively.
We have already done 2 MG projects with this organization in the last decade & half.

Dear Rotarians:
Congratulations! Your global grant application for funding to provide two kidney dialyses machines
to both the Oum El Nour Hospital and Kanater el Khairia Hospital, as well as health awareness
training in Cairo and Qalyubia Governorate, Egypt, submitted by the Rotary Club of Heliopolis and
the Rotary Club of Harwich-Dennis, has been approved by The Rotary Foundation. The award is in
the amount of $46,750.
